About

Dr. Isais Tesfazion is a hematologist oncologist practicing in Fairfax, VA. Dr. Tesfazion specializes in the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of blood diseases such as anemia, hemophilia, sickle-cell disease, leukemia and lymphoma. Hematologist Oncologists are also trained in the study of cancer and its attack on other organs.

Get to know Hematologist-Oncologist Dr. Isaias Tesfazion, who serves patients throughout the State of Virginia.

As a fellowship-trained hematologist-oncologist, Dr. Tesfazion is affiliated with the following hospitals in Virginia: Reston Hospital Center, Virginia Hospital Center, Inova Fair Oaks Hospital, Inova Fairfax Hospital, and Kaiser Permanente Fair Oaks Medical Center.

His acclaimed career in medicine began after he earned his medical degree from Addis Ababa University Faculty of Medicine in 1980. He then went on to perform his residency in internal medicine and his fellowship in medical oncology at Howard University Hospital in 1992 and 1995, respectively. 

With over forty years of experience in his field, Dr. Tesfazion is board-certified in internal medicine by the American Board of Internal Medicine (ABIM). The ABIM is a physician-led, non-profit, independent evaluation organization driven by doctors who want to achieve higher standards for better care in a rapidly changing world.

Hematology is the branch of medicine concerned with the study of the cause, prognosis, treatment, and prevention of diseases related to blood. Oncology is a branch of medicine that deals with the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of cancer. A hematologist-oncologist is a physician who specializes in the diagnosis, treatment, or prevention of cancer, malignant blood diseases such as leukemia, lymphoma, and multiple myeloma, and blood disorders such as iron-deficiency anemia, clotting abnormalities, hemophilia, and sickle-cell disease.
